There are a few ways you can add someone to your Microsoft family, but the easiest way to set up and manage members is to go to account.microsoft.com/family and then do the following:
-
Sign in with your Microsoft account, then select Add a family member.
-
Select Child or Adult.
-
Type an email address or mobile phone number for the person you want to add and select Send invite. (If your child doesn’t have an email account or mobile number, select Create a new one for them.)
-
Have the person you’ve invited accept your invitation from their email or text message, or go to account.microsoft.com/family and select Accept now next to their email address. You’ll find it in the Notifications section at the top of the page under Pending member.
-
If you selected Accept now, sign out so the person you’re trying to add can sign in and join the family. Then, sign back in and finish setting things up.
If the person you're adding is already part of another family, they'll first need to be removed from that family.
Add an existing child account on your PC to your family
If your child already has a user account on your PC, you can add them to your family.
- Have your child sign in to the PC.
- Select the Start button > Settings , and then select Accounts .
- Select Your account.
- If your child doesn't currently sign in with a Microsoft account, select Sign in with a Microsoft account and then type their email address. You'll use their email address to add them to your family in a little while.
- If an email address is associated with their account, make note of it. You'll use it to add them to your family.
- Next, you can add this child account to your family in one of two ways:
- Sign in to your PC and select the Start button > Settings > Accounts > Family and other users. Then, select Add a family member and follow the instructions on the screen.
-or- - Sign in at account.microsoft.com/family and add them to your family.
Until they accept your invitation to join your family from their email, they'll be able to sign in without having any family settings, restrictions, or monitoring applied to their account.
Add a family member on Xbox One
The way you add someone to your Microsoft family on Xbox One depends on whether they’re new to Xbox Live or already have an Xbox Live account. For kids who are new to Xbox Live, add them to your family on the console, then manage their family settings on account.microsoft.com/family. Otherwise, they may not appear in your list of family members on the console.
If your child doesn’t have an Xbox Live account
- Press the Xbox button to open the guide, then select Sign in and sign in with your account.
- Press the Xbox button again and select System > Settings > Account > Family > Add to family > Add new.
- When the person you want to add is prompted to sign in using their Microsoft account email address, press B on your controller, then move the left stick down to select Get a new account, and have them follow the steps to create a Microsoft account.
- When you’re prompted, select Add to family.
If your child has has an Xbox Live account on your console
- Press the Xbox button to open the guide, then select Sign in and sign in with your account.
- Press the Xbox button again and select System > Settings > Account > Family > Add to family.
- Select the profile for the person you want to add, then press the A button on your controller.
If your child has an Xbox Live account that’s not on your console
- Press the Xbox button to open the guide, then select Sign in and sign in with your account.
- Press the Xbox button again and select System > Settings > Account > Family > Add to family > Add new.
- Have the person you want to add sign in with their Microsoft account email address and password, and when you’re prompted, select Add to family.
